X-inefficiency
The difference between efficient behavior of businesses under competitive environments versus the inefficiency that arises in the absence of competition.
Competitive Firms
Companies that operate in markets where no single firm has the power to influence the price of goods and services significantly.
Monopolistic Firms
Companies that have significant control over the market for a particular good or service, allowing them to influence price and production levels.
Economic Inefficiency
A situation where resources are not used in the most productive way, often leading to waste or a loss of potential output.
